Fast-food chain specializing in frozen custard & signature burgers made with Midwest beef & dairy.

Espresso Toffee Bar: Culver’s originated in Sauk City, WI back in 1984. When I was a doughy kid in the 90's it had expanded slightly and I have fond memories of visiting the location in nearby Wisconsin Dells while on vacation. Today, Culver’s can be found in 26 states serving up their famous Butterburgers and custard. For those unfamiliar with custard, it's similar to ice cream, except it includes eggs. The eggs give custard a smooth and extra creamy texture. Espresso Toffee Bar is currently one of Culver's rotating Flavor of the Day options. This custard has a rich espresso flavor swirled with old fashioned salted caramel, crunchy bits of Heath Bar, and gooey butter cake pieces. Beginning with the espresso base, it was perfect. Texturally it was smooth and creamy with the flavor not being too intense or bitter. My dish's mix-ins were not distributed very evenly, but when I got the rare bite containing all three (caramel, Heath Bar, and cake) it was superb. If you've never had a Heath Bar, they're crunchy toffee flavored candy bars. In this case, they go well with the espresso custard. I thought the cake pieces had a predominately vanilla flavor, with a hint of butter mostly masked by the espresso custard. Really my only complaint is it could have used more caramel, which was delicious but scant. Overall, this flavor is a must try for coffee/espresso lovers, but your typical frozen treat enthusiast will probably enjoy it too. Doughboy...
